DescriptionFUNCTION: Catalytic component of the GATOR2 complex, a multiprotein complex that acts as an activator of the amino acid-sensing branch of the mTORC1 signaling pathway . The GATOR2 complex indirectly activates mTORC1 through the inhibition of the GATOR1 subcomplex . GATOR2 probably acts as an E3 ubiquitin-protein ligase toward GATOR1 . In the presence of abundant amino acids, the GATOR2 complex mediates ubiquitination of the NPRL2 core component of the GATOR1 complex, leading to GATOR1 inactivation . In the absence of amino acids, GATOR2 is inhibited, activating the GATOR1 complex . In addition to its role in regulation of the mTORC1 complex, promotes the acidification of lysosomes and facilitates autophagic flux . Within the GATOR2 complex, WDR24 constitutes the catalytic subunit that mediates 'Lys-6'-linked ubiquitination of NPRL2 . .
